When an aging HVAC system reaches the end of its useful life — or when you want to upgrade to a more efficient modern system — proper installation makes all the difference. Professional Heating and Cooling installs new heating and cooling systems for homes and businesses throughout Your Area and , with the expertise to size and configure the system correctly for your specific space.

Oversized or undersized systems cost more to run and wear out faster. We use industry-standard load calculations (Manual J) to ensure your new system is exactly the right size — not just a swapped-out replacement of whatever was there before.

How long does a new HVAC system installation take?
Most standard residential replacements (same equipment type, same location) are completed in one day. New installations requiring ductwork modifications or additions may take one to two days. We'll give you a specific timeline during your free estimate appointment.

Is a heat pump a good choice for Your Area's climate?
Modern cold-climate heat pumps perform efficiently down to very low outdoor temperatures, making them a strong choice for most climates. We'll evaluate your heating load, utility rates, and existing ductwork to give you an honest comparison of heat pump vs. traditional split system for your specific situation.
Are there rebates or tax credits available for new HVAC systems?
Yes. High-efficiency HVAC systems may qualify for federal tax credits under the Inflation Reduction Act (up to 30% of cost for heat pumps) and utility rebates from your local provider. We'll identify and help you claim applicable incentives when you get your free estimate.
